+/**
+ * Test KafkaConsumer close and destructor behaviour.
+ */
+
+
+struct args {
+ RdKafka::Queue *queue;
+ RdKafka::KafkaConsumer *c;
+};
+
+static int run_polling_thread(void *p) {
+ struct args *args = (struct args *)p;
+
+ while (!args->c->closed()) {
+ RdKafka::Message *msg;
+
+ /* We use a long timeout to also verify that the
+ * consume() call is yielded/woken by librdkafka
+ * when consumer_close_queue() finishes. */
+ msg = args->queue->consume(60 * 1000 /*60s*/);
+ if (msg)
+ delete msg;
+ }
+
+ return 0;
+}
+
+
+static void start_polling_thread(thrd_t *thrd, struct args *args) {
+ if (thrd_create(thrd, run_polling_thread, (void *)args) != thrd_success)
+ Test::Fail("Failed to create thread");
+}
+
+static void stop_polling_thread(thrd_t thrd, struct args *args) {
+ int ret;
+ if (thrd_join(thrd, &ret) != thrd_success)
+ Test::Fail("Thread join failed");
+}
+
+
+static void do_test_consumer_close(bool do_subscribe,
+ bool do_unsubscribe,
+ bool do_close,
+ bool with_queue) {
+ std::string testname = tostr()
+ << "Test C++ KafkaConsumer close "
+ << "subscribe=" << do_subscribe
+ << ", unsubscribe=" << do_unsubscribe
+ << ", close=" << do_close << ", queue=" << with_queue;
+ SUB_TEST("%s", testname.c_str());
+
+ rd_kafka_mock_cluster_t *mcluster;
+ const char *bootstraps;
+
+ mcluster = test_mock_cluster_new(3, &bootstraps);
+
+ std::string errstr;
+
+ /*
+ * Produce messages to topics
+ */
+ const int msgs_per_partition = 10;
+ RdKafka::Conf *pconf;
+ Test::conf_init(&pconf, NULL, 10);
+ Test::conf_set(pconf, "bootstrap.servers", bootstraps);
+ RdKafka::Producer *p = RdKafka::Producer::create(pconf, errstr);
+ if (!p)
+ Test::Fail(tostr() << __FUNCTION__
+ << ": Failed to create producer: " << errstr);
+ delete pconf;
+ Test::produce_msgs(p, "some_topic", 0, msgs_per_partition, 10,
+ true /*flush*/);
+ delete p;
+
+ /* Create consumer */
+ RdKafka::Conf *conf;
+ Test::conf_init(&conf, NULL, 0);
+ Test::conf_set(conf, "bootstrap.servers", bootstraps);
+ Test::conf_set(conf, "group.id", "mygroup");
+ Test::conf_set(conf, "auto.offset.reset", "beginning");
+
+ RdKafka::KafkaConsumer *c = RdKafka::KafkaConsumer::create(conf, errstr);
+ if (!c)
+ Test::Fail("Failed to create KafkaConsumer: " + errstr);
+ delete conf;
+
+ if (do_subscribe) {
+ std::vector<std::string> topics;
+ topics.push_back("some_topic");
+ RdKafka::ErrorCode err;
+ if ((err = c->subscribe(topics)))
+ Test::Fail("subscribe failed: " + RdKafka::err2str(err));
+ }
+
+ int received = 0;
+ while (received < msgs_per_partition) {
+ RdKafka::Message *msg = c->consume(500);
+ if (msg) {
+ ++received;
+ delete msg;
+ }
+ }
+
+ RdKafka::ErrorCode err;
+ if (do_unsubscribe)
+ if ((err = c->unsubscribe()))
+ Test::Fail("unsubscribe failed: " + RdKafka::err2str(err));
+
+ if (do_close) {
+ if (with_queue) {
+ RdKafka::Queue *queue = RdKafka::Queue::create(c);
+ struct args args = {queue, c};
+ thrd_t thrd;
+
+ /* Serve queue in background thread until close() is done */
+ start_polling_thread(&thrd, &args);
+
+ RdKafka::Error *error;
+
+ Test::Say("Closing with queue\n");
+ if ((error = c->close(queue)))
+ Test::Fail("close(queue) failed: " + error->str());
+
+ stop_polling_thread(thrd, &args);
+
+ Test::Say("Attempting second close\n");
+ /* A second call should fail */
+ if (!(error = c->close(queue)))
+ Test::Fail("Expected second close(queue) to fail");
+ if (error->code() != RdKafka::ERR__DESTROY)
+ Test::Fail("Expected second close(queue) to fail with DESTROY, not " +
+ error->str());
+ delete error;
+
+ delete queue;
+
+ } else {
+ if ((err = c->close()))
+ Test::Fail("close failed: " + RdKafka::err2str(err));
+
+ /* A second call should fail */
+ if ((err = c->close()) != RdKafka::ERR__DESTROY)
+ Test::Fail("Expected second close to fail with DESTROY, not " +
+ RdKafka::err2str(err));
+ }
+ }
+
+ /* Call an async method that will do nothing but verify that we're not
+ * crashing due to use-after-free. */
+ if ((err = c->commitAsync()))
+ Test::Fail("Expected commitAsync close to succeed, got " +
+ RdKafka::err2str(err));
+
+ delete c;
+
+ test_mock_cluster_destroy(mcluster);
+
+ SUB_TEST_PASS();
+}
+
+extern "C" {
+int main_0116_kafkaconsumer_close(int argc, char **argv) {
+ /* Parameters:
+ * subscribe, unsubscribe, close, with_queue */
+ for (int i = 0; i < 1 << 4; i++) {
+ bool subscribe = i & (1 << 0);
+ bool unsubscribe = i & (1 << 1);
+ bool do_close = i & (1 << 2);
+ bool with_queue = i & (1 << 3);
+ do_test_consumer_close(subscribe, unsubscribe, do_close, with_queue);
+ }
+
+ return 0;
+}
+}
